## Changelog — GarageSense Feed v3.2

Renamed OCC_FEED_TOKEN_OLD to OCC_FEED_AUTH to match the new Lorvik gateway naming scheme. The old name is read for one more release, then removed. Update deployment env files when convenient; both names cannot be set simultaneously or startup aborts. The gateway still requires the feed credential at boot. In .env, the renamed setting appears as the line below.

sealed setting: RELAY_SECRET5=82864

**Vendor note: Inkmill markdown pipeline**

Rendering for Parchway docs is outsourced to Inkmill under an annual contract, renewing each March. They handle sanitization and PDF export; we own the upload queue. SLA: 4-hour response on rendering failures. Escalate only after two failed retries. Their support desk is reachable at the address below.

billing contact of hahaf-baguf = zorael.tammir.jorius@sivrelhq.internal

## Ownership

The Moonpool tide-table widget is maintained by the Coastal Features group at Saltmere Digital. It pulls predictions from the Brinewatch forecast service and caches them for 24 hours, so stale tides usually mean a cache issue rather than bad data. Support should not edit widget configs directly; instead, escalate tickets to the widget owner. The current owner's full name is listed below.

named custodian: Brivan Eliath Quenox Frador

## Limits & Quotas — Catalog Cache Invalidation

Future maintainers: the Shopgrove catalog cache invalidates entries through a fan-out queue, and every quota here exists because of a past incident. Bulk price updates can enqueue millions of invalidations, so we cap burst size and enforce a per-tenant budget. Exceeding the budget defers invalidations rather than dropping them, which temporarily serves stale data by design. The enforced values are listed below.

tuning table, yajog-yahof:
BUDGETS = {
    "lamvan": 303,
    "wenox": 460,
    "fenvan": 525,
}

Changed defaults in Splitfork, our assignment service. Bucketing now uses sticky hashing per account instead of per session, and the holdout slice grew from 2% to 5%. Callers relying on session-level reassignment must opt in explicitly. Review the diff against the new baseline; the updated default configuration is listed below.

config for tagep-kajof:
[casir]
port = 6379
region = south-1
host = casir.paliqdyn.example
team = tamax
timeout_ms = 250
retries = 2